## Limits and Quotas — Bannerline Rollout

The Bannerline consent service enforces per-region quotas so a misconfigured tenant cannot flood the preference store. Write rates are capped per visitor session, and consent-state reads are served from a signed cache to bound backend exposure. Quota breaches return a safe default (consent withheld) rather than failing open. The enforced limits are as follows.

tuning constants:
TIERS = {
    "fenath": 357,
    "fraax": 107,
    "holir": 183,
}

**Ticket PV-218: Metrics sidecar vault locked**

The Pulsegrain metrics-aggregation sidecar can't fetch its export credentials; the Corvel vault sealed after three failed unseal attempts overnight. Plugin authors are blocked from publishing collectors until it's open. Rotation isn't scheduled until next sprint, so we're using the documented emergency path. Unseal from the sidecar host with the recovery passphrase below.

vault phrase of fafop-kagug = zorox-zorwyn

Ticket: FARE-2291 — Price variant B not applied on mobile web

The Skylark ticket-pricing experiment shows variant A prices to all mobile users, regardless of bucket assignment.

Repro steps:
1. Clear cookies and open the Glimmerline mobile site.
2. Force bucket B via the experiment override panel.
3. Add any event ticket to the cart.
4. Observe variant A pricing at checkout.

To replay the assignment call against staging, authenticate with the bearer token below.

session JWT of yawep-yawep = eyJhbGciOiJIUzI1NiIsInR5cCI6IkpXVCJ9.eyJzdWIiOiI3pWF3_In0.aXYsHiog

## Deploying the Gatewick Proctor Queue

Deploys are pretty painless: push to main, wait for the pipeline, then watch the queue drain dashboard for five minutes. If candidates pile up mid-exam, roll back first and ask questions later — the queue replays safely. Everything the workers care about lives in one config block, shown here for reference.

settings of bafof-yagef:
JOROX_PIN=8740
JOROX_TENANT=pelox
JOROX_METRICS_HOST=metrics.jorox.qorvelworks.internal
JOROX_SEAL=seal_c78f63c1
JOROX_STANDBY_TEAM=norax